Output 9078726f37230dc1d8dd84dbda12f3c8a55d6f053fa35a0672f1aa37bbf1c45e:0

value
572491
script pubkey
OP_0 OP_PUSHBYTES_20 8e18c248fe96ddabf225bb057eaf08c5451d7204
address
bc1q3cvvyj87jmw6hu39hvzhatcgc4z36usyltcedm
transaction
9078726f37230dc1d8dd84dbda12f3c8a55d6f053fa35a0672f1aa37bbf1c45e
spent
true